'PIFA Colaba FC are an Indian Mumbai District Football Association - League football club based in Mumbai, Maharashtra. Founded by Premier India Football Academy in 2005.
History
The Club team was founded by Nirvan Shah and Anjali Shah which was the natural growth path of Premier India Football Academy (PIFA). The team mainly consisted of players from Colaba community and students from the PIFA.
The club team is coached by co founder Nirvan Shah (UEFA B) played the Senior division MDFA league in 2005-06 having finished runners up, it got promoted to Super division.
In 2006-07, they once again finished runners up and got promoted to Elite Division. Ever since then they have remained in the MDFA Elite division. The highest position they achieved was 3rd place in the MDFA Elite division in 2010-11. They were runners up of the Nadkarni Cup and winners of the Abhijeet Kadam Memorial Trophy in 2011.
In 2010-11, they qualified to play the AIFF 2nd Division i league tournament. They have been playing all the editions of the AIFF 2nd Division i league since then.
The club also has the following teams :
U19 - AIFF U19 i league, MDFA 1st Division.
U17 - MDFA 2nd Division.
U15 - AIFF MUPC.
WOMENS - MDFA Womens Division
